How We Rate Transfer Colleges

The CTG Transfer Rating is College Transfer Guide's independant editorial assessment of how welcoming and supportive a college is for transfer students.

Unlike traditional college rankings, our ratings focus specifically on the transfer experience. We evaluate factors such as:

• Transfer acceptance rates
• Credit transfer policies
• Transfer advising and student support
• Affordability and value
• Overall transfer friendliness

Each college receives a 0–100 CTG Transfer Rating along with a descriptive category, making it easier to compare schools from a transfer student's perspective.

Our ratings are intended to complement—not replace—your own research when choosing the right college.

Transfer Snapshot

Centre College is a smaller private college located in Danville, Kentucky. It enrolls approximately 1400 students and has listed tuition of $52,820.00. The school reports approximately 80 annual transfer students. Transfer students can contact Shery Boyles directly for admissions guidance.

College Description

Centre College is a private liberal arts college in the Presbyterian tradition committed to developing the whole person. Centre's mission is to provide a superior, demanding, and transformative liberal education in the arts and sciences to students of high potential cultivating graduates of intellectual breadth, ethical character, and civic commitment who are prepared for lives of leadership, service, and meaning.
